World History Encyclopedia
Category
General History
Type
Study Aids
Language
English
The World History Encyclopedia (formerly the Ancient History Encyclopedia) provides a multitude of resources to engage the public in world history and cultural heritage. There are numerous encyclopedia-style articles on a range of historical and archaeological topics including, art and architecture, daily life, biographies of famous individuals, places, states, time periods, religions, and warfare. The coverage of the site is primarily ancient and medieval, but it is expanding into the Medieval, Early Modern, and Modern periods. There is also a repository of materials for educators such as timelines, quizzes, a media library, and translations of ancient documents. There is also a growing collection of YouTube videos and podcasts on world history subjects. Many of the articles have been translated into a variety of languages.

Achemenet
Category
Ancient Near Eastern Languages & Civilizations
Type
Research Materials
Language
French; English
This website contains various tools and resources for the study of the Achaemenid Persian Empire, including texts, translations, bibliography, information on archaeological sites, images, maps, museum information, and online publications. Texts are arranged by language (Aramaic, Babylonian, Egyptian, Elamite, Greek, Lycian, and multilingual), region (Anatolia, Babylon, Egypt, Fars, and Greece), and publication.

Thesaurus Linguae Gracae (TLG)
Category
Ancient Greek & Roman Studies
Type
Ancient Texts
Language
English

This website contains searchable, full-texts for every known piece of Greek literature from Homer to the Medeival period, including scholia, Church fathers, prose, and poetry. Each word is linked to relavent lexica and concordances. Advanced search capabilities make this an indispensible tool for philologists. More well-known authors have links to online translations. Individual and institutional subscriptions are available. Individuals must obtain a one-year subscription to use.

The Ancient Graffiti Project
Category
Ancient Greek & Roman Studies
Type
Ancient Texts
Language
English

This website contains a searchable database of texts and translations of graffiti from Pompeii, Herculaneum, and Smyrna, as well as interactive maps of those cities. There are also lessons plans and materials for teachers.
